One of the first decisions to make when embarking on a van conversion project is choosing the right type of van. Popular choices include Sprinter vans, Ford Transits, and Promasters, as they offer ample space and height for building out a comfortable living space. It’s important to consider not only the size of the van but also its fuel efficiency, maintenance costs, and overall durability.

When it comes to the interior design of your van conversion, the options are truly limitless. Some popular features to consider including in your conversion are a bed platform with storage underneath, a small kitchenette with a sink and stove, a composting toilet, and solar panels for off-grid power. Depending on your budget and personal preferences, you can choose to splurge on high-end finishes and appliances or opt for more budget-friendly options.

Another important aspect of van conversions to consider is insulation and ventilation. Proper insulation is crucial for regulating the temperature inside the van and keeping it comfortable during both hot summers and cold winters. Ventilation is also key to preventing condensation and ensuring good air quality inside the van. Consider installing windows, roof vents, and fans to keep air flowing throughout the space.

One of the biggest challenges of van conversions is finding creative solutions for storage. With limited space, it’s important to make the most of every inch by incorporating clever storage solutions like overhead cabinets, under-bed storage, and fold-down tables. Utilizing vertical space and hidden compartments can help keep your belongings organized and out of the way.

As you embark on your van conversion journey, don’t forget to consider the exterior of your van as well. A well-designed exterior can make a big impact and reflect your personal style. Consider adding a roof rack for additional storage, a ladder for easy access to the roof, or a bike rack for outdoor adventures.
